如何使用 CN1069 进行数据处理
本文将指导您如何使用 CN1069 模块进行基本的数据处理任务。CN1069 是一种常见的通信模块,适用于 IoT 设备,能够通过简单的命令与传感器或其他设备进行交互。下面的内容将帮助您为 CN1069 的使用做好准备,并提供详细的操作步骤。
操作前的准备
在开始之前,请确保您具备以下条件:
- 一块 CN1069 模块。
- 一个支持 UART 或 SPI 的开发板,例如 Arduino 或 Raspberry Pi。
- 安装适当的连接线和电源。
- 相应的开发环境,例如 Arduino IDE 或其他适合您开发板的编程环境。
完成任务的分步操作指南
步骤一:连接 CN1069 模块
按照以下步骤将 CN1069 模块连接到您的开发板:
- 确认 CN1069 的引脚图,连接电源(VCC 和 GND),确保模块得到适当的电源。
- 选择一种通信方式,连接数据引脚。例如,若使用 UART 方式,连接 RX 和 TX 引脚。
- 如果需要SPI通讯,连接 SCK、MISO 和 MOSI 引脚。
步骤二:安装相关库和软件
在 Arduino IDE 中,您可能需要安装特定的库以便与 CN1069 进行通信。可以通过以下步骤安装:
- 打开 Arduino IDE,点击 库管理器。
- 搜索与 CN1069 相关的库,例如 “CN1069″。
- 点击“安装”按钮来安装库。
步骤三:编写代码
编写代码以初始化模块并进行数据读取。以下是一个基本示例:
#include <CN1069.h>
CN1069 cn1069;
void setup() {
Serial.begin(9600); // 初始化串口通信
cn1069.begin(); // 初始化CN1069模块
}
void loop() {
if (cn1069.available()) {
String data = cn1069.readData(); // 从模块读取数据
Serial.println(data); // 打印读到的数据
}
}
步骤四:上传代码并测试
将代码上传到开发板后,打开串口监视器,设置波特率为 9600。您应该能够看到 CN1069 输出的数据。如果没有,请检查连接和代码中的逻辑。
常见问题及注意事项
在操作过程中,您可能会遇到以下问题:
- 连接问题: 请确保所有连线稳固,确保电源连接正常。
- 数据读取问题: 如果无法读取到数据,可以尝试调整波特率,确保它与 CN1069 的设置一致。
- 库依赖问题: 有时需要安装多个库才能获得完整功能,请查阅 CN1069 的文档。
另外,确保您使用的开发环境和软件版本与 CN1069 模块兼容,以减少潜在的问题。
总结
通过以上步骤,您应能够成功连接和使用 CN1069 模块进行基本的数据处理。确保您在操作中仔细检查每一步,以避免常见的错误。祝您项目顺利!